Castro Valley, CA (December 8, 2024) – Emergency responders were dispatched to the scene of a traffic collision at the intersection of Grove Way and Redwood Rd, occurring at approximately 1:26 PM. The collision involved a blue Toyota RAV4 and a red Toyota SUV. Initial reports indicated that the blue Toyota RAV4 was in the right turn lane on Redwood Rd when the collision took place. Airbags deployed in the blue Toyota, and it was reported as not drivable.
The owner of the blue Toyota RAV4 requested a tow and confirmed that funds were available for the towing service. No specific injuries have been confirmed at this time, as the severity of the injuries remains unknown.
